definitely, Blue Bayou !! reserve for 11:30 am lunch, get there 15 minutes early and ask for a waterfront table. (or, if you go at another time, ask for waterfront and wait extra for it..... usually not too long.)
Kids menu available and good prices there.
So YES to BLUE BAYOU...…. it's IN the ride ...… nothing else like it !!
 
The best WOW factor is eating just at dusk at the Cozy Cone in Radiator Springs just as they turn on the lights to “Sha-Boom”
We often grab dinner at the SmokeJumpers and walk it over to the picnic tables at Cozy cone. My boys think they’ve died and gone to heaven ( and they are 15 and 17 now) to be immersed in Cars Land

Just thought I'd throw in that I have 5 kids (spread across a number of years with a 17-year gap in between, so basically 2 generations of kids), and all have adored Blue Bayou. It was always our special treat place and we're generally in and out fairly quickly (they sometimes make me feel a little rushed, though). It's too bad they got rid of some of the neat touches for kids, like pirate hat menus and the pirate ship cookie boat dessert, but the atmosphere is really what my kids liked best, including the pirate boats going by, and hey, they do have glow cubes now :) . My kids love the special treatment you get from nicer restaurants (servers bringing you things, special dishes, things like that) which is a wow factor of its own.
